La Palma, CA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in La Palma?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| La Palma Studio Apartments | $2,346 | $1,495 | $2,832 |
La Palma 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,537 | $1,400 | $4,230 |
| La Palma 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,821 | $1,850 | $4,610 |
| La Palma 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,278 | $2,950 | $4,125 |

Frequently Asked Questions about 1 Bedroom La Palma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in La Palma with 1 Bedroom?
Currently the most affordable 1 Bedroom in La Palma is at Renaissance Park listed at $1,695.
How much is the average rent for a 1 Bedroom La Palma Apartment?
The average rent for a 1 Bedroom Apartment in La Palma is $2,537.
What is the largest available 1 Bedroom La Palma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in La Palma is a 800 square feet unit starting from $1,950 at Lincoln Apartments.
What is the average size for La Palma 1 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 1 Bedroom rental in La Palma is currently 730 sq ft.
